Blockchain miners play a crucial role in maintaining the integrity of cryptocurrency networks. They are responsible for securing transactions, verifying them, and adding them to the blockchain ledger, which is publicly accessible and immutable.
What are Blockchain Miners?
A blockchain miner is an individual or organization that uses computing power to validate transactions and create new blocks on a blockchain network. They operate specialized hardware called mining equipment, such as ASICs (Application-Specific Integrated Circuits), GPUs (Graphics Processing Units), and FPGAs (Field Programmable Gate Arrays). Miners use this hardware to solve complex mathematical problems that are designed to verify transactions and create new blocks.
The process of mining involves several steps:
-
Transactions: These are the individual units of currency that are exchanged between users.
-
Validation: The network verifies that the transactions are valid and meet certain criteria, such as the sender has enough funds to complete the transaction.
-
Block creation: Once the transactions are verified, they are grouped into a block and added to the blockchain ledger.
-
Proof of work: The miner must solve a complex mathematical problem to create a new block. This process is known as proof-of-work (PoW) and requires a significant amount of computational power.
-
Block rewards: Once a new block is added to the blockchain, the miner who solved the mathematical problem is rewarded with a portion of the newly minted currency.
The Role of Blockchain Miners in Cryptocurrency Networks
Blockchain miners play a critical role in maintaining the security and integrity of cryptocurrency networks. Their primary function is to validate transactions and create new blocks on the blockchain ledger. This process helps ensure that the ledger remains immutable and that no one can tamper with it.
There are several ways in which miners contribute to the security of decentralized systems:
-
Decentralization: Blockchain networks are decentralized, meaning they have no central authority controlling them. Miners help maintain this decentralization by validating transactions and creating new blocks on the network.
-
Security: Miners help secure the network by verifying transactions and ensuring that they meet certain criteria. This process helps prevent fraudulent transactions from being added to the ledger.
-
Transparency: The blockchain ledger is publicly accessible, which means anyone can view it and verify the accuracy of the data. Miners help ensure this transparency by adding new blocks to the ledger.
-
Scalability: Blockchain networks are scalable, meaning they can handle a large number of transactions without slowing down or becoming overloaded. Miners help achieve this scalability by validating transactions and creating new blocks on the network.
Blockchain Miners vs. Centralized Authorities
One of the key advantages of blockchain networks is that they do not rely on centralized authorities to validate transactions and maintain the integrity of the ledger. Instead, this responsibility falls to miners, who use their computing power to verify transactions and create new blocks on the network.
There are several reasons why decentralized systems are more secure than centralized systems:
-
Decentralization: Decentralized systems have no central authority controlling them. This means that there is no single point of failure, making it much harder for hackers to compromise the system.
-
Transparency: Decentralized systems rely on a publicly accessible ledger, which allows anyone to view and verify the accuracy of the data.
-
Immutability: Once data is added to the blockchain ledger, it is permanently stored there and cannot be altered or deleted. This helps prevent fraudulent activity and ensures the integrity of the data.
Case Studies in Blockchain Mining
There are several examples of blockchain miners contributing to the security and integrity of decentralized systems. Here are a few:
-
Bitcoin: The first and most well-known cryptocurrency, Bitcoin relies on miners to validate transactions and create new blocks on the network. Miners use specialized hardware to solve complex mathematical problems, which helps maintain the integrity of the ledger.
-
Ethereum: Another popular cryptocurrency, Ethereum is used for a variety of purposes beyond just trading, including building decentralized applications (dApps). Miners on the Ethereum network help maintain the integrity of the ledger and ensure that dApps operate smoothly.
-
Monero: A privacy-focused cryptocurrency, Monero uses miners to verify transactions and add them to the blockchain ledger. The use of advanced cryptographic techniques helps protect user privacy and prevent fraudulent activity.
Summary
Blockchain miners play a critical role in maintaining the security and integrity of decentralized systems. They help validate transactions, create new blocks on the network, and ensure that the ledger remains immutable. By using specialized hardware to solve complex mathematical problems, miners contribute to the scalability, transparency, and decentralization of cryptocurrency networks.
FAQs
Here are some frequently asked questions about blockchain mining:
-
What is a blockchain miner?
-
What is the process of mining?
-
What is the role of miners in cryptocurrency networks?
Note: The FAQs section should not be wrapped in any tags, as it is just a list of questions and answers.